4. Jacquard :
Jacquard is a shedding device
placed on the top of the loom
to produce large figure
patterns by controlling a very
large no. of warp threads
separately by means of
harness cords, hooks and
needles.
It was invented by Joseph Marie Jacquard

7. Single lift Jacquard (Construction)
Single Lift Single Cylinder Jacquard is the
original and the simplest type of jacquard.
It works on bottom closed shed type of shedding
mechanism.
Here one set of knife with griffe controlled the
hooks. The hooks are controlled by needles of
one cranked eye and every needle is selected
one hook in that pick.
One neck cord with harness cord is controlled by
this mechanism

9. Single lift single cylinder center
shed Jacquard Mechanism :
During the cycle of operation one of the faces of the cylinder together with a card
is brought against the needle board. If a hole is punched in the card the
corresponding needle will project through in the cylinder. the hook controlled by
that needle will remain is such a position that its upper hooked end un punched
will be caught by the raising knife. The un punched position of the card will press
back the needle & consequently the hook controlled by that will be away from the
path of the using knife. Thus the hook gets selection according to the design cut
for a particular card.
When the hooks are lifted by the knives the cylinder moves out a limited
distance. A catch holds it against the top corner of the cylinder. The cylinder is
turned about its axis & new card is presented to the needles during its next cycle.
By this time the griffe along with its knives descend to lower the warp threads to
the bottom shed line for a fresh warp threads to the bottom shed line for a fresh
selection of the hook at the next pick.

10. Advantage & Disadvantage :
Advantage :
• Tremendous design possibilities,
• Simpler in principle than dobby's.
Disadvantage :
• Large scale moving parts makes the machine and its harness relatively costly to install and
maintain.
• Jacquard fabrics are much more costly to produce.
• Jacquard machines are even more liable to produce faults in the fabric than dobbies.
• Pattern change is a time consuming process.
• Until recently, the jacquard machine had tended to impose limitations (300 picks/min )
• Jacquard shedding is normally used only when the cloths to be woven are outside the scope of
dobby shedding.
